While exploring Kolhapur, don't miss the hidden gem of Dajipur Wildlife Sanctuary. Located around 120 kilometers from the city, this sanctuary is home to diverse flora and fauna, including the majestic Indian Bison. Embark on a safari and experience the thrill of spotting wildlife up close.
Another local favorite is the Kopeshwar Temple, located in Khidrapur, around 60 kilometers from Kolhapur. This ancient temple showcases intricate carvings and architectural brilliance, making it a must-visit for history and art enthusiasts.
